Adecco Healthcare & Life Sciences is currently looking to hire a skilled and motivated Cardiovascular Interventional Technologist (CIT) to join our team. In this role, you will support a variety of cardiovascular, neurovascular, and electrophysiology procedures, working closely with physicians and clinical teams to deliver high-quality patient care.
What You’ll Do
Provide scrub assistance during interventional procedures
Assist with case preparation including balloon prep, stent deployment, and valve setup
Operate fixed and mobile angiography imaging equipment
Enter patient demographics and ensure accurate data documentation
Archive images in Cardiac and Radiology PACS systems
Support use of ancillary equipment (IVUS, Impella, IABP, AngioJet, etc.)
Maintain sterile technique and procedural standards
Stock procedure rooms and ensure equipment readiness
Perform routine cleaning and maintain a safe environment
Complete documentation in EPIC and inventory systems
Qualifications
Education:
Associate’s Degree required
Bachelor’s Degree preferred
Knowledge & Skills:
Understanding of radiologic imaging principles and techniques
Knowledge of cardiovascular procedures, supplies, and equipment
Familiarity with anatomy, physiology, and disease processes
Strong communication and teamwork skills
Ability to work in a fast-paced, patient-focused environment
Certifications Required
BLS (Basic Life Support)
ACLS (within 180 days of hire)
CRT
ARRT (Radiography)
Fluoroscopy Certification (within 90 days)
